private Token ProduceToken(Stack<Token> groupStack, LookAheadBuffer lookAheadBuffer) { while (true) { Token read = LookAheadDFA(lookAheadBuffer); if (read.Type == SymbolType.GroupStart && (groupStack.Count == 0 || groupStack.Peek().Group.Nesting.Contains(read.Group.TableIndex))) { lookAheadBuffer.Consume(read.Data.Length); read.EndPosition = lookAheadBuffer.Position; groupStack.Push(read); } else if (groupStack.Count == 0) { //The token is ready to be analyzed. lookAheadBuffer.Consume(read.Data.Length); read.EndPosition = lookAheadBuffer.Position; return read; } else if (Object.ReferenceEquals(groupStack.Peek().Group.End, read.Symbol)) { //End the current group Token pop = groupStack.Pop(); if (pop.Group.Ending == GroupEndingMode.Closed) { pop.Data += read.Data; lookAheadBuffer.Consume(read.Data.Length); read.EndPosition = lookAheadBuffer.Position; } //We are out of the group. Return pop'd token (which contains all the group text) if (groupStack.Count == 0) { //Change symbol to parent pop.Symbol = pop.Group.Container; return pop; } else { groupStack.Peek().Data += pop.Data; } } else if (read.Type == SymbolType.End) { return read; } else { //We are in a group, Append to the Token on the top of the stack. //Take into account the Token group mode Token top = groupStack.Peek(); if (top.Group.Advance == GroupAdvanceMode.Token) { // Append all text top.Data += read.Data; lookAheadBuffer.Consume(read.Data.Length); } else { // Append one character top.Data += read.Data[0].ToString(); lookAheadBuffer.Consume(1); } read.EndPosition = lookAheadBuffer.Position; } } }
